Jupiter could make an ideal dark matter detector
So you want to find dark matter, but you don't know where to look. A giant planet might be exactly the kind of particle detector you need! Luckily, our solar system just happens to have a couple of them available, and the biggest and closest is Jupiter. Researchers Rebecca Leane (Stanford) and Tim Linden (Stockholm) released a paper this week describing how the gas giant just might hold the key to finding the elusive dark matter.

A rare conjunction of Jupiter and Saturn will be visible to the naked eye for the first time in 800 years
Jupiter and Saturn are due to converge in their orbits on Monday, appearing as a double planet in the night sky — the first such occurrence in almost 800 years. The two planets have been near one another throughout the year, according to Rice University astronomer Patrick Hartigan. They will reach their closest approach, passing within 0.1 degrees of each other during the winter solstice on December 21, the longest night of the year.

Jupiter and Saturn will come within 0.1 degrees of each other, forming the first visible "double planet" in 800 years
Before 2020 comes to a close, Jupiter and Saturn will be so close that they will appear to form a "double planet." The great conjunction, as the planetary alignment has come to be known, hasn't occurred in nearly 800 years. When their orbits align every 20 years, Jupiter and Saturn get extremely close to one another. This occurs because Jupiter orbits the sun every 12 years, while Saturn's orbit takes 30 years — every couple of decades, Saturn is lapped by Jupiter, according to NASA.

Mysterious ‘elves’ and ‘sprites’ seen in Jupiter’s atmosphere
Strange “sprites” or “elves” have been seen on Jupiter from Nasa’s Juno mission. The supernaturally-named phenomena refer to transient luminous events – bright, unpredictable, and bizzaire flashes of light. It is the first time such events have ever been seen on another world, Nasa says. The lights on the solar system’s largest planets were predicted by scientists, who thought that they would be observed in Jupiter’s liquid-like atmosphere.

Jupiter's ocean moons raise tides on each other
Jupiter's "ocean world" moons may have strong gravitational effects on each other, raising big tides in each others' subsurface seas, a new study suggests. Surprisingly, these moon-moon tidal forces might generate more heat in the satellites' oceans than the gravitational tugs of giant Jupiter, study team members found.

Freaky ‘Active’ Object in Jupiter’s Orbit Is First of Its Kind Seen by Astronomers
It’s neither an asteroid nor a comet but something in between. It’s also parked within Jupiter’s orbit, making this object the first of its kind to ever be detected. Say hello to 2019 LD2, the only active Jupiter Trojan known to science. Trojans are a large group of asteroids located in the same orbital path as Jupiter, and they’re all dead, inert asteroids – well, except apparently this one, which now boasts a very comet-like tail, according to a press release put out by the University of Hawaii’s Institute for Astronomy.

Is Jupiter a Failed Star?
Although Jupiter is large as planets go, it would need to be about 75 times its current mass to ignite nuclear fusion in its core and become a star.
